The phrase “red flags” has gained immense traction as a buzzword — a shorthand for warning signs or potentially harmful behaviors in a person that turns up on our radar. It’s possible that you already know or have a list of red flags to watch out for in others.

While this awareness is necessary to know what you want and what you simply will not accept from people, the problem arises when you’re only pointing fingers at the other person without reflecting on your own behavior.

1. Notice How You Handle Conflict

Conflicts can often reveal parts of you that feel unsafe and where your red flags may show up the loudest. Disagreements naturally threaten your sense of safety, acceptance or control. A tense situation with someone you love and care about has the potential to bring unresolved emotions to the surface.

Conflicts often bring up deeper emotional wounds and unconscious defense mechanisms like shutting down, lashing out or deflecting. You may not even be aware of them or how they might be affecting the other person and your relationship with them.

In research published in The Spanish Journal of Psychology in 2021, 405 young Spanish couples were examined to see how their attachment styles (anxious, avoidant or secure) influenced the way they handled conflict in their romantic relationships.

The researchers found that:

People with anxious attachment were more likely to use conflict engagement (like yelling, blaming or escalating the issue). These often led to lower relationship satisfaction.
Those with avoidant attachment tended to withdraw during conflicts, avoiding communication or shutting down emotionally, which was also linked with poorer relationship quality.
People with secure attachment were more likely to use positive problem-solving, such as open communication and compromise, which was tied to greater relationship satisfaction.

So, observing your patterns in terms of handling conflict is necessary to be mindful of their impact. This helps you understand deeper emotional patterns that may be impacting the quality of your relationships. The more awareness you gain, the more you can learn to respond in ways that build connection rather than break it.

2. Notice How You Apologize

The ability to apologise genuinely without defensiveness is a sign of emotional maturity. It is possible that your apologies may be shaped more by seeking relief and less by repair. While that’s understandable and can naturally happen to most people without realization, it becomes important to pause and reflect on where your apology is coming from.

A 2022 study explored two major aspects of apology. Firstly, researchers focused on understanding what makes someone more likely to give a sincere and high-quality apology after hurting someone. Secondly, they looked at why others might avoid apologizing altogether.

This was studied through two online vignette experiments. The researchers looked at two types of humility:

Intellectual humility. Being open to the idea that you might be wrong or have more to learn.
General humility. Having a grounded, modest view of yourself overall.

It was found that people with more general humility gave better-quality apologies and were less likely to avoid fixing the issue across all types of conflict. People with intellectual humility only gave better apologies in situations specifically involving disagreements or intellectual issues. People who made more empathic effort (trying to understand how the other person feels) and were less focused on protecting their ego were more likely to apologize well.

This study highlights that the quality of your apology is deeply tied to internal traits, such as your capacity for humility, empathy and tolerance of being wrong.

Reflecting on your apology pattern is about understanding deeper emotional habits, unresolved fears and relational red flags that may be at play. Your “apology language” reflects how you handle vulnerability and responsibility in close relationships, both of which are foundational in building healthier connections.

Bringing more awareness to your ways of apologizing helps you rework the way you relate and connect with people and enhances the quality of your relationships in the long run.

3. Notice How You React When Someone Sets a Boundary

Boundary setting essentially plays a key role in sustaining healthy and emotionally safe relationships. Whether it’s setting your own or respecting another person’s, what determines the health of a relationship is not just the boundary, but the way both people respond to it.

Often, if you struggle to recognize and assert your boundaries, you may also have difficulty recognizing or respecting those of others. This lack of awareness can lead you to unknowingly indulge in potentially harmful behaviors that might threaten the trust and emotional safety within the relationship.

A 2024 study published in Personality and Environmental Issues sought to systematise existing psychological knowledge on how personal boundaries impact mental and relational health. The study specifically goes in depth on how boundaries are defined, exploring the different types as well as their essential functions in regulating interpersonal space.

Instead of defining boundaries as just rules or preferences, they were defined as an internal and external psychological spaces that help us differentiate ourselves from others — including physical, emotional, mental and even spiritual boundaries.

Each serves a different but equally important function in preserving any individual’s psychological autonomy and relational balance. The researchers highlight the importance of assertiveness as a regulating force in the case of boundary setting. Simply put, assertiveness helps you advocate for yourself while also remaining open to connection. This is a trait that people who struggle with boundaries often lack.

So, if you happen to recognize a negative reaction when a boundary is set (feeling rejected, trying to control the other person or withdrawing), it could reveal your underlying boundary issues or emotional vulnerabilities.

While boundary difficulties may feel hard to unlearn, it’s important to remember they often stem from patterns outside your control and are not your fault. But they are worth reflecting on. This is beneficial not just for your well-being but also communicates respect and care for those you love. Ultimately, focusing on them helps you maintain your peace and cultivate a healthier environment for relationships.
